A person makes a choice, but fate leaves no choice at all.
This is a play about a love that proves stronger than the heavy, centuries-old chains of tradition, and a passion that turns every prohibition to ashes.
Lorca’s brilliant drama brings to life a world where family duty and love challenge each other to a duel.
Where does the line between tradition and personal freedom lie? What is love capable of — destruction or creation?
A wedding that was meant to be a celebration of life turns into a fatal ritual where death becomes the host.
And yet, what does the color orange belong to — death or life?
